Geotechnical engineers analyse all the field examination records to guarantee that construction is going on according to the job requirements. Throughout building and construction, a confirmatory test for dirt compaction is done on-site to guarantee that no future settlement takes place


After the concrete is poured -7 days and 28 days- tests are carried out on concrete examples accumulated from the website to ensure that the concrete poured fulfills the layout standard. Asphalt core is taken after the Asphalt is laid and compressed to confirm that it fulfills the style standard. All lab examination records are evaluated by the Geotechnical Engineer to guarantee that it fulfills the task specification.

These operations enable specialists to assess a host of dirt auto mechanics consisting of weight, porosity, void-to-solid fragment ratio, permeability, compressibility, optimum shear stamina, birthing capacity and contortions. If the framework needs a deep structure, engineers will certainly make use of a cone penetration test to approximate the quantity of skin and end bearing resistance in the subsurface.




 


When evaluating an incline's balance of shear stress and anxiety and shear stamina, or its capability to hold up against and go through activity, rotational slides and translational slides are typically taken into consideration. Rotational slides fail along a curved surface, with translational slides occurring on a planar surface area. A specialist's goal is to establish the problems at which a slope failure might happen.


Usually, findings recommend that a site's dirt ought to be treated to improve its shear stamina, tightness and leaks in the structure prior to style and building and construction. When it comes time to outline more tips here structure plans, professionals are significantly concentrated on sustainability, more particularly just how to lower a foundation's carbon footprint. One technique has actually been to replace 20 percent of a foundation's cement with fly ash, a waste item from coal fire nuclear power plant.
